Jose Celaya

A 2000 graduate of Alisal High School, Jose Celaya fought his way up through east Salinas and into the national boxing spotlight starting in 1997 by becoming a three-time USA National champion at 139 pounds. He won the gold medal in 1998 at the USA under-19 tournament, and was a bronze medal winner at the US Golden Gloves and PAL champion in 1999. Celaya was an alternate on the US 2000 Olympic boxing team. As a pro, he won the NABO welterweight title belt in 2002 and at the same time was ranked No. 1 in the world by the WBO at 147 pounds. His pro record was 31-7 with 16 knockouts and his amateur mark was 75-17.
